In 2020-2021, 2,214 people earned their degree in natural sciences, making the major the 208th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, natural sciences gra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$25,745 and had an average of $18,648 in loans still to pay off.

Across Minnesota, there were 21 natural sciences gra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Schools Highly Focused on Natural Sciences Major in Minnesota” ranking, we looked at 5 colleges that offer a degree in natural sciences. The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their natural sciences program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.
